GE washer error code 3E80

Understanding the GE Washer Error Code 3E80

The GE washer error code 3E80 indicates a communication issue between the control board and the motor control unit. This error typically arises due to electrical malfunctions, such as faulty wiring, a defective control board, or issues with the motor itself. Users may experience longer wash cycles, intermittent operation, or complete failure to start the washer. In some cases, this error can pose safety risks, such as overheating or electrical shorts, making it crucial to address the issue promptly.

Common Causes of Error Code 3E80

  • Faulty wiring connections between the control board and motor control unit.
  • Defective control board that fails to communicate properly.
  • Malfunctioning motor control unit.
  • Electrical surges or fluctuations affecting the washer’s components.
  • Moisture or corrosion in electrical connectors.

Troubleshooting Steps for Error Code 3E80

  1. Unplug the washer from the power source for at least 5 minutes to reset the control board.
  2. Inspect all wiring connections for signs of damage or loose connections.
  3. Check the motor control unit for any visible signs of wear or damage.
  4. Test the control board with a multimeter to ensure it is functioning correctly.
  5. If the error persists, consider replacing the motor control unit or control board.
